Other Information
Played in three TOUR events in 2004, with one made cut--T68 at the Bank of America Colonial. Also played five Nationwide Tour events, with a best finish of T19 at the Chitimacha Louisiana Open. Career has been sidetracked by numerous injuries, necessitating surgeries on back (1989), both knees (1994) and neck (1995). Despite setbacks has two TOUR victories, the 1986 Colonial Invitational and NEC World Series of Golf. Finished fifth on TOUR money list in 1986, with $463,630. Winner of the 1987 Vardon Trophy and Epson Stats All-Around title. Member of U.S. Ryder Cup squad in 1987. Led the PGA TOUR in Driving Distance in 1980-81. Lost playoff to Craig Stadler in 1982 Masters. Michigan State Amateur champion in 1975 and 1977. Named to the Michigan Golf Hall of Fame in May 2004. Has been involved in course design work, including the PohlCat Golf Course in Mt. Pleasant, MI.
